This quiz will test your movies knowledge by asking you questions related to the various famous movie trivia from the Hollywood movie: Dogma (1999).
About the movie:
An abortion clinic worker with a special heritage is called upon to save the existence of humanity from being negated by two renegade angels trying to exploit a loophole and re-enter Heaven.
